Title :
STSIC detection for multi-user MIMO MC-CDMA systems

Abstract :
In this paper space time serial interference cancellation (STSIC) detection technique is proposed for multi-user multiple-input multiple-output (MIMO) multi-carrier code division multiple access (MC-CDMA) system to over come the affects of multiple access interference (MAI) caused by other users present in the system. STSIC technique combines the receiver diversity and serial interference cancellation (SIC) in overcoming MAI. The proposed system outperforms the optimal multi-user detection (MUD) and linear MUD techniques in overcoming the affects of MAI. It is also found that Gold codes are preferred over random codes in increasing the system performance.
